CUSTOMS ENFORCEMENT OF INTELLECTUAL PROPERTY RIGHTS
This advanced law course will provide an in-depth exploration of the role of customs enforcement in the protection and regulation of intellectual property rights (IPR) on a global scale. Students will examine the legal frameworks, enforcement mechanisms, and the challenges faced by customs authorities in combating counterfeiting and piracy. The course will also delve into the intersections between customs law, intellectual property law, and international trade law, providing students with a comprehensive understanding of the complexities involved in IPR enforcement at borders.
